Women's Soccer Falls at Iowa, 2-0

IOWA CITY, Iowa -- The Western Michigan women's soccer team opened up the 2019 regular season falling at the University of Iowa, 2-0, on Thursday night.

The Hawkeyes scored a goal in each half, with the opening tally coming in the 11th minute by Kaleigh Haus. Haus netted her first goal of the season on an assist from Hannah Dkrulec to give Iowa the early 1-0 lead.

UI struck again in the 82nd minute on a penalty kick goal by Natalie Winters to seal the game.

"Iowa was a very good team," said head coach Sammy Boateng.
